On novel coronavirus source tracing
China has acted in a fact-based manner and with an open, transparent and cooperative approach to maintain communications with the World Health Organization concerning the origins of the COVID-19, and provided the WHO missions support during their work in China.
The COVID-19 pandemic is a global public health crisis. China also hopes to know the source of the virus as early as possible in order to better understand the spread of the virus and take more effective measures to contain it. (Read more)
